    ABOUT CLAIRE PONSFORD

    Claire is co-founder and owner of Wavelength International. With a proud 25-year history, Wavelength has one of the largest and longest-standing medical recruitment teams in Australia, offering both permanent and locum recruitment services in all specialties and seniorities. Claire is also a shareholder and Board Director in an Australian telehealth business.

    With a background in Health Sector Human Resources management and medical workforce planning in both the UK and Australia, Claire is passionate about sourcing, attracting, onboarding and retaining talent. Having grown Wavelength from two to 100 staff, she also has first-hand experience of some of the challenges of hiring for growth and the benefits of choosing the right people to join your team.

    ABOUT GEORGE SOTIRIS

    George Sotiris is the Founder and Director of HR in Health, a leading provider of proactive HR solutions and support to the health industry nationwide. With a career spanning over 15 years, George has established himself as a Workplace Relations Specialist dedicated to serving the unique needs of healthcare practices.


    Driven by his genuine appreciation for the challenges inherent in healthcare HR management, George founded HR in Health in 2018. Since its inception, the organisation has been committed to empowering practices with the knowledge and tools needed to navigate complex employment issues and build robust systems for fostering better workplaces.


    George firmly believes that the success of any practice hinges on strong employment foundations and accountability at every level. By simplifying intricate staffing disputes and offering comprehensive education on HR best practices, George, and his team at HR in Health strive to make a tangible difference in the health industry

    ABOUT AJAY KOSHTI

    Dr Ajay Koshti, MBBS, FRACGP, MRCGP (UK)

    Dr Ajay has 21 years of experience in hospital medicine, General Practice and business management. Dr Ajay enjoys a wide variety of general practice presentations and has special interests in Diabetes management, Cosmetic Medicine, Occupational health and management of work-related injuries. Dr Ajay is a fellow of Royal Australian College of General Practitioners (FRACGP). He completed his primary medical qualification (MBBS) in 2002 in India and postgraduate training in general practice – MRCGP, from Scotland in 2008. He was a partner in a large GP Surgery in Scotland and served as a Clinical Director for the local health board. Dr Ajay also has an MBA with distinction from Strathclyde Business School, Glasgow and was involved in training GP. He is fluent in English, Gujarati and Hindi.
